ip http enable
Use
ip http enable
to enable the HTTP service.
Use
undo ip http enable
to disable the HTTP service.
Syntax
ip http enable
undo ip http enable
Default
The HTTP service is disabled.
Views
System view
Default command level
2: System level
Usage guidelines
The default setting of this command varies with devices.
The device can act as the HTTP server that can be accessed only after the HTTP service is enabled.
Examples
# Enable the HTTP service.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] ip http enable
# Disable the HTTP service.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] undo ip http enable
